Francis L. “Butch” Kehler Jr., 71, of Centre St., Ashland, passed away Saturday, December 22nd, at the Veteran’s Administration Hospital, Lebanon.
Born in Hegins, March 6, 1947, he was the son of the late Francis L. and Elsie Carl Kehler Sr. He was a graduate of the former Ashland Area High School, class of 1966, and was immediately drafted by the U.S. Army. Francis served in Vietnam as a Para Trooper with the 5th Air Borne Special Forces Group, attaining the rank of Sergeant. He earned the National Defense Service Metal, Vietnam Service Metal, Vietnam Campaign Metal, Vietnam Cross of Gallantry with Palm Air Metal, Combat Infantryman’s Metal, and the Purple Heart on September 14, 1968, for wounds received in combat action.
Francis was a member of the Bethany Evangelical Congregational Church, Ashland, were he served as church stuart and church treasurer. He owned and operated Francis Kehler Contracting Company, Ashland, until his retirement, His other memberships included the American Hose Company, V.F.W. Post #7654, American Legion Post #434, and the Good Fellowship Club, all of Ashland.
Preceding him in death was his wife of 42 years, Judith Ann Kehler, passing in December of 2010, also sisters Gloria Schoffler, Geraldine Leese, Rita Wright, and Loraine Sliger.
